Class ModelCompareOptions

java.lang.Object
com.evolveum.midpoint.model.api.ModelCompareOptions
All Implemented Interfaces:
Serializable, Cloneable

public class ModelCompareOptions extends Object implements Serializable, Cloneable
Options to be used for compareObject calls. EXPERIMENTAL
See Also:
  • Constructor Details

    • ModelCompareOptions

      public ModelCompareOptions()
  • Method Details

    • getComputeCurrentToProvided

      public Boolean getComputeCurrentToProvided()
    • setComputeCurrentToProvided

      public void setComputeCurrentToProvided(Boolean computeCurrentToProvided)
    • isComputeCurrentToProvided

      public static boolean isComputeCurrentToProvided(ModelCompareOptions options)
    • getComputeProvidedToCurrent

      public Boolean getComputeProvidedToCurrent()
    • setComputeProvidedToCurrent

      public void setComputeProvidedToCurrent(Boolean computeProvidedToCurrent)
    • isComputeProvidedToCurrent

      public static boolean isComputeProvidedToCurrent(ModelCompareOptions options)
    • getReturnNormalized

      public Boolean getReturnNormalized()
    • setReturnNormalized

      public void setReturnNormalized(Boolean returnNormalized)
    • isReturnNormalized

      public static boolean isReturnNormalized(ModelCompareOptions options)
    • getReturnCurrent

      public Boolean getReturnCurrent()
    • setReturnCurrent

      public void setReturnCurrent(Boolean returnCurrent)
    • isReturnCurrent

      public static boolean isReturnCurrent(ModelCompareOptions options)
    • getIgnoreOperationalItems

      public Boolean getIgnoreOperationalItems()
    • setIgnoreOperationalItems

      public void setIgnoreOperationalItems(Boolean ignoreOperationalItems)
    • isIgnoreOperationalItems

      public static boolean isIgnoreOperationalItems(ModelCompareOptions options)
    • toModelCompareOptionsType

      public ModelCompareOptionsType toModelCompareOptionsType()
    • fromModelCompareOptionsType

      public static ModelCompareOptions fromModelCompareOptionsType(ModelCompareOptionsType type)
    • fromRestOptions

      public static ModelCompareOptions fromRestOptions(List<String> options)
    • toString

      public String toString()
      Overrides:
      toString in class Object
    • clone

      public ModelCompareOptions clone()
      Overrides:
      clone in class Object